diff options
| author | Thomas Gleixner <tglx@linutronix.de> | 2025-07-18 20:54:06 +0200 |
|---|---|---|
| committer | Thomas Gleixner <tglx@linutronix.de> | 2025-07-22 14:30:42 +0200 |
| commit | 46958a7bac2d32fda43fd7cd1858aa414640fbd1 (patch) | |
| tree | 7d2478759145dc3ec692a1f9810cf9e0b83f5cc5 /kernel | |
| parent | 66067c3c8a1ee097e9c30e8bbd643b12ba54a6b0 (diff) | |
genirq: Remove pointless local variable
The variable is only used at one place, which can simply take the constant
as function argument.
Signed-off-by: Thomas Gleixner <tglx@linutronix.de>
Tested-by: Liangyan <liangyan.peng@bytedance.com>
Link: https://lore.kernel.org/all/20250718185311.884314473@linutronix.de
Diffstat (limited to 'kernel')
| -rw-r--r-- | kernel/irq/chip.c | 4 |
1 files changed, 1 insertions, 3 deletions
diff --git a/kernel/irq/chip.c b/kernel/irq/chip.c index 2b274007e8ba..5bb26fc5368b 100644 --- a/kernel/irq/chip.c +++ b/kernel/irq/chip.c @@ -466,13 +466,11 @@ static bool irq_check_poll(struct irq_desc *desc) static bool irq_can_handle_pm(struct irq_desc *desc) { - unsigned int mask = IRQD_IRQ_INPROGRESS | IRQD_WAKEUP_ARMED; - /* * If the interrupt is not in progress and is not an armed * wakeup interrupt, proceed. */ - if (!irqd_has_set(&desc->irq_data, mask)) + if (!irqd_has_set(&desc->irq_data, IRQD_IRQ_INPROGRESS | IRQD_WAKEUP_ARMED)) return true; /* |